My Signature Dish Wolfgang Puck’s Smoked Salmon Pizza

Recipe: Step 1: Lay the side of salmon on a sheet pan and evenly spread the pickling salt. Step 2: Cover and refrigerate for 24 hours. Rinse off excess salt and pat dry. Step 3: Cold smoke, using alderwood chips for 8 hours. Do not allow the temperature to rise or the salmon will cook. Slice thinly.

House Smoked Salmon Thyme & Again

1. Brine Your Salmon. Your first step is to brine your salmon. A basic brine recipe is 1 quart water, 1/3 cup kosher salt and 1 cup brown sugar. After mixing all your brine ingredients together, pour it over your salmon and let it rest in a large container in the fridge, for no less than 4 hours, but no more than 48 hours.

House Smoked Salmon

Brush the maple glaze generously over the surface of the salmon fillets. Close the lid of the pellet smoker and smoke the salmon at 225°F (107°C) until the internal temperature of the salmon reaches around 140°F (60°C), usually about 1 to 1.5 hours depending on the thickness of the fillets.
